Template:Species-infobox Template:Quote2 Tucks are pudgy, hunched penguins who appear as common enemies in Donkey Kong Country: Tropical Freeze. They are act as the grunts of the Snowmads, comparable to Tiki Goons from Donkey Kong Country Returns. Tucks wear tightened green striped pants with a knotted rope around their waist. Tucks' name is likely derived from 'tuxedo', which penguins are often said to be wearing in reference to their black and white feather pattern.

Tucks walk slowly from side to side. If the Kongs get in contact with a Tucks, it slaps them, causing them to lose a heart of their health. Tucks are among the weakest enemies in the game and can be defeated by any attack, such as a stomp or a roll attack. Tucks sometimes appear in groups, so the Kongs can jump on them in succession to potentially earn a Banana Coin.
